o
IMPORTANT
Video input that includes copyright signals
(for example digital content designated as "copy
once" or copy protected) cannot be recorded.
The video input will
be
recorded normally until
the point a copyright signal
is
detected.
Depending on the analog signal sent from the
connected device the input image may be
distorted or not be displayed at all (for example,
video input that includes anomalous signals
such as ghost signals).
CD
NOTES
We recommend powering the camcorder with
the compact power adapter.
